Publication number: 20250178086Abstract: An ultrathin device, manufacturing method therefor and use thereof. The method includes: granulating a mixture containing raw material powder, an adhesive and a solvent into particles by spray drying to obtain first precursor, the raw material powder including metal material powder and/or ceramic material powder, a surface mean diameter of the raw material powder ranging from 1 ?m to 15 ?m, a mass ratio of the raw material powder to the adhesive ranging from 100:1 to 100:10, a surface mean diameter of the first precursor ranging from 40 ?m to 80 ?m, and flowability of the first precursor being lower than 30 s/50 g; performing shaping process on the first precursor to obtain second precursor having a preset shape; and performing heat treatment on the second precursor to obtain the ultrathin device with a thickness smaller than or equal to 1 mm. The thickness is reduced without having a significant impact on the mechanical properties.Type: ApplicationFiled: June 5, 2024Publication date: June 5, 2025Inventors: Jinhui Yu, Zhongyou Wu, Quan Xie, Ben Li

Publication number: 20240002451Abstract: The present disclosure belongs to the technical field of virus immunoassay and provides a broad-spectrum peptide antigen of SARS-CoV-2, a specific neutralizing antibody and use thereof. A broad-spectrum peptide antigen of SARS-CoV-2, with an amino acid sequence set forth in SEQ ID NO: 1, reacts with human SARS-CoV-2 positive serum, and can specifically bind to a novel coronavirus antibody. Based on the peptide sequence of the present disclosure, a fusion protein with broad-spectrum triple tandem peptides of SARS-CoV-2 is prepared using PCR, prokaryotic expression and protein purification technology to simulate the trimeric mode of SARS-CoV-2 S protein in its natural state. The fusion protein is used as an antigen to immunize mice, and can produce a specific anti-SARS-CoV-2 neutralizing antibody. The neutralizing antibody may be promising in anti-infective treatment, vaccine development and detection kit development for SARS-CoV-2.Type: ApplicationFiled: July 21, 2021Publication date: January 4, 2024Inventors: Jianqiang YE, Tuofan LI, Qiuqi KAN, Aijian QIN, Zhimin WAN, Hongxia SHAO, Quan XIE

Patent number: 9835930Abstract: An auto focus device comprises a focus panel and a focus controller. The focus panel comprises liquid crystal between a first light-transmissive conductive film and a second light-transmissive conductive film, and the focus controller is configured to apply a voltage between the two light-transmissive conductive films at the position of at least one pixel, so that the liquid crystal at the position will have an expected focal length. An auto focus method comprises: acquiring information on eyesight status of a user; acquiring information on posture of the user; calculating expected focal length of the liquid crystal between the two light-transmissive conductive films at the position of at least one pixel according to the acquired user information; selecting a voltage to be applied between the two light-transmissive conductive films at the position according to the expected focal length; and applying the voltage between the two light-transmissive conductive films at the position.Type: GrantFiled: April 11, 2014Date of Patent: December 5, 2017Assignee: International Business Machines CorporationInventors: Guo Qiang Hu, Qi Cheng Li, Yi Min Wang, Fang Quan Xie, Bo Yang, Zi Yu Zhu

Patent number: 9811446Abstract: A method and apparatus for providing a test case for a modified program. The method includes the steps of: obtaining a modification item that makes modification on a previous version of the program; locating the modification item after a first instrument and before a second instrument of a plurality of instruments inserted into the program; obtaining an execution path of the modified program that is between the first instrument and the second instrument and associated with the modification as well as a constraint set corresponding to the execution path; obtaining an execution result, outputted by the first instrument, of executing the previous version of the program using an original test case; and determining a test case applicable for the execution path based on the execution result and the constraint set. The apparatus corresponds to the method.Type: GrantFiled: June 6, 2014Date of Patent: November 7, 2017Assignee: INTERNATIONAL BUSINESS MACHINES CORPORATIONInventors: Qi Cheng Li, Li Jun Mei, Jian Wang, Fang Quan Xie, Zi Yu Zhu
